The Ellen Boniuk Early Childhood School is one of the West Houston's finest preschools. Our caring, professional staff provide quality infant and child care and Jewish enrichment. We celebrate Jewish heritage and traditions through school-wide Shabbat, snack and holiday celebrations. We incorporate Jewish customs and values into our daily curriculum.

On August 10, our young scientists mixed, poured, and experimented at our Potion Party! What may look like play is actually powerful learning: children explored cause and effect, measured and compared, and delighted in the unexpected changes their hands created.

Potions invite wonder, curiosity, and discovery — each child is a researcher, shaping their own path of exploration. Just as every ingredient adds something unique to the potion, each child’s perspective adds beauty and possibility to our world.

Day 3 of Professional Development Week brings us into the art studio, where every brushstroke became a prayer. Through process art, we explored how each child is created B’tzelem Elohim — in the Divine image — and how their unique expressions reflect infinite beauty and possibility. In our Reggio-inspired practice, the art is not about the product, but about honoring the sacred journey of creation itself. Our second session invites us to see Jewish holidays as moments of wonder, sparking curiosity, connection, and joy in our classrooms all year long. Evelyn Rubenstein JCC
